About This Coffee

This coffee is from Tesfaye Bekele's Suke Quto Farm in Guji, Ethiopia. The lot was processed at the Suke Quto Washing Station, where it was depulped with mucilage left on and fermented for 35 to 48 hours before being dried on raised beds. The coffee is described as floral and sweet. Tesfaye Bekele pioneered modern Guji coffee by replanting the region after fires destroyed forests and farms about 15 years ago. This coffee is sourced through importing partner Trabocca.

MOK Specialty Coffee

Founded in 2012 by Jens Crabbe, MOK began as a small roastery and bar in Leuven before expanding to Brussels. Jens, a two time former Belgian Cup Tasters Champion, is driven by a desire to explore the full potential of coffee flavor. MOK's philosophy is centered on an omni roast approach, where they develop one ideal roast profile for each coffee that works for both filter and espresso. This method aims to showcase the coffee's inherent sweetness and terroir with maximum clarity and minimal roast influence.
